Build a tree-climbing house for your cat. If you or a family member is a handy person with
building small things this is a good idea and cost is very inexpensive. You do not want to make it to high, as we
do not want to teach a cat to jump from high places. Get some type of idea how much room the cat needs when they
are curled up sleeping, you can make a little area particular enclosed for the cat to sleep. Make from the bottom
to the next level high enough to allow the cat for a scratching pole. Have a small shelve on it for the cat to sit
and play with some toys or couple of toys on a stick with string attached so that cat can swat at the toy. If the
wood does not splinter, you can use just the bare wood. If you are going to paint or stain the scratching post,
take time to check out your local paint store for suggestions on this. You would not want to harm the cat if they
would lick or try to gnaw the wood. Putting carpeting is a good idea. Cats do not like to get claws snag on
anything.
